Thousands of fans to attend Russian GP, despite increase in COVID infections

The Russian Grand Prix will let in as many as 30,000 people to the circuit in Sochi this weekend. After the successful experiment with a few thousand fans in Mugello, Russia is now trying to up the numbers. The coronavirus held back the start of the Formula 1 season for a long time, but nine races have already taken place. During the last race in Mugello, a few fans were admitted.
